cant see the pic but,...........
if its the car im thinking of, it should be the racing dynamics front spoiler for an e28. mounting an e28is style spoiler isnt that difficult. keep in mind the front bumpers have a slightly different shape so the spoiler will not match the bumber lines exactly........

I kind of did a mock up, and it didn't seem close or easy. On the other hand, I've also got an E24 euro front air dam sitting in the garage, a Zender IIRC, and it does look doable with a minimum of hassles. I wouldn't go so far as to say it couldn't be done, but not easily.
